We do gas streaks by drawing them in a paint program (Fractal Painter on the PC, usually) and then using the resulting image as a color and/or transparency map.

I have an Amiga 2000 w/ Fusion 40 68040 @25MHz. I recently leased a 90 MHz EISA PC for rendering. In my initial tests, I used an old logo animation and rendered it on both machines. Frames rendering in 3:55 on the Amiga rendered in 0:29 on the PC.

I've noticed that sometimes the slice function has problems with perfectly coplanar faces within the objects slicing each other. One of the things you might try is selecting one of your obects, rotating it, say, .1 degrees in each axis (use the transformation requester) and then re-trying your slice. This…
